Fort Worth has a variety of top-notch schools, from elementary to high school, making it an excellent choice for families. The Fort Worth Independent School Districtoffers numerous programs tailored to student needs. You'll also find acclaimed colleges and universities, such as Texas Christian University (TCU) , known for its excellent academic and athletic programs.
Getting around Fort Worth is convenient as its connected via major highways like I-35W and I-30, making commuting simple and efficient. Public transportation options include the Trinity Metro rail service, offering accessible routes throughout the metro area. For those who travel frequently, the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port (DFW) is just a short drive away. Living here means you'll never feel far from where you need to be.
Fort Worth is a city that proudly embraces its Texas roots. Known as "Where the West Begins," Fort Worth offers a unique blend of Cowtown charm and modern amenities. Enjoy live rodeo shows at the historic Fort Worth Stockyards , or experience local art at the Kimbell Art Museum. The city is also home to the Fort Worth Zoo , one of the top-ranked zoos in the country. Sports fans will love the local teams, including the Texas Rangers and the Dallas Cowboys; there's a team for just about every fan. Average rent prices in Fort Worth range from $1,200 a month for a one-bedroom apartment to up to $3,000 a month for a three-bedroom unit. Prices vary based on location and amenities.
Fort Worth offers convenient public transportation options through Trinity Metro, including buses and rail services. Visit ridetrinitymetro.org for schedules and routes.

The West 7th district and Sundance Square are known for their energetic nightlife, with lots of bars, restaurants, and live music venues.
The Trinity Trails offer over 100 miles of paved trails for biking and hiking throughout the city. There are also over 300 parks in Fort Worth , not to mention all the green space to be explored in the surrounding suburbs!
Fort Worth residents love their sports teams, including the Texas Rangers (MLB) and the Dallas Cowboys (NFL). Catch a game at AT&T Stadium , and be sure to wear your white and blue!
Tanglewood Elementary and Paschal High School are highly-rated public schools in Fort Worth. You can learn more about those schools on the FWSID website. In the greater Fort Worth area, there are fantastic school districts such as Carrollton-Farmers Branch , Grapevine-Colleyville , and Carroll Independent School Districts , making the quality and culture of suburban education accessible.
Fort Worth has a diverse economy, with major industries including aerospace and aviation, healthcare, and manufacturing. Companies like Lockheed Martin and Bell Nexus call Fort Worth their home, as does Oatly Oat Milk ! The diversity of industries that make up Fort Worth's workforce contributes to the city's vast job offerings and ever-growing local economy.
Experience fine dining at places like Joe T. Garcia 's, known for its Mexican cuisine; Wicked Butcher , with modern steakhouse vibes and a menu to match; and Reata , famous for its Texas-inspired dishes. Lucile's Stateside Bistro has served the comforts of casual American cuisine for over 30 years, bringing the perfect mix of plaid tablecloths, high-quality steaks, and locally praised paella to the Fort Worth community. While the city boasts plenty of prime spots for choice cuts, there's also a wide selection of vegan and veggie-centric offerings, including Spiral Diner and Maiden Vegan.
